Hi Brett,
The hat is my Derby, but the steel in the showcase is the first Sho~Bud I built for myself. They originally asked for a Derby hat, a bar, and a set of picks, but seeing as how the Sho~Bud company originated in the Nashville area, I thought it might offer some historical value for the city.
